[U-Boot] [PATCH] Add some second source legacy flash chips 256x8

Signed-off-by: Niklaus Giger niklaus.giger@member.fsf.org ---
We tested some boot flashes as possible second source. As some had ids above 0x7f, we had to implement JEDEC JEP106Z in cfi_flash.c. I now that I just missed the merge window, but the patches are not urgent and I was away for a three week

diff --git a/drivers/mtd/cfi_flash.c b/drivers/mtd/cfi_flash.c index 81ac5d3..4cd0116 100644 --- a/drivers/mtd/cfi_flash.c +++ b/drivers/mtd/cfi_flash.c @@ -106,6 +106,8 @@ #define ATM_CMD_SOFTLOCK_START 0x80 #define ATM_CMD_LOCK_SECT 0x40
+#define FLASH_CONTINUATION_CODE 0x7F + #define FLASH_OFFSET_MANUFACTURER_ID 0x00 #define FLASH_OFFSET_DEVICE_ID 0x01 #define FLASH_OFFSET_DEVICE_ID2 0x0E @@ -1541,13 +1543,21 @@ static int cmdset_intel_init(flash_info_t *info, struct cfi_qry *qry)
static void cmdset_amd_read_jedec_ids(flash_info_t *info) { - flash_write_cmd(info, 0, 0, AMD_CMD_RESET); + ushort bankId = 0; + uchar manuId; + + flash_write_cmd(info, 0, 0, AMD_CMD_RESET); flash_unlock_seq(info, 0); flash_write_cmd(info, 0, info->addr_unlock1, FLASH_CMD_READ_ID); udelay(1000); /* some flash are slow to respond */
- info->manufacturer_id = flash_read_uchar (info, - FLASH_OFFSET_MANUFACTURER_ID); + manuId = flash_read_uchar (info, FLASH_OFFSET_MANUFACTURER_ID); + /* JEDEC JEP106Z specifies ID codes up to bank 7 */ + while(manuId == FLASH_CONTINUATION_CODE && bankId < 0x800) { + bankId += 0x100; + manuId = flash_read_uchar (info, bankId | FLASH_OFFSET_MANUFACTURER_ID); + } + info->manufacturer_id = manuId;
